Agilent Technologies appoints Mike McMullen as CEO

Agilent Technologies has appointed Mike McMullen, its president and chief operating officer, as the chief executive officer.

McMullen succeeds William (Bill) Sullivan.

McMullen is Agilent’s third president and CEO since the company spun off from Hewlett-Packard Co. in 1999. He has more than 30 years experience with Agilent and Hewlett-Packard.

As president of Agilent’s Chemical Analysis Group from 2009 until 2014, he was responsible for the chemical and energy, food and environmental markets, as well as the services and consumables business for the Chemical Analysis and Life Sciences groups.

As president, chief operating officer and CEO-elect from September 2014, he was responsible for overseeing Agilent Technologies three businesses including Life Sciences and Applied Markets Group, Agilent CrossLab Group, and Diagnostics and Genomics Group; Order Fulfillment; and the global organization that houses IT, workplace services, global sourcing and logistics.
